Output e959666ce49e16e644c59c3cc513e6f2f7153ad1426db896052bcd25b2e196e3:7

value
297536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f3108ee7eb9f41076705e7dc4495fc8ab6d52ed OP_EQUAL
address
3BpwfqiZSESLE8asqPAvz4y9b5gob6JbSx
transaction
e959666ce49e16e644c59c3cc513e6f2f7153ad1426db896052bcd25b2e196e3
spent
true